Output e05406b430a8c889a31fff7ff4b9e458666603213a125838e3b61b6fd0e3f05e:0

value
38956000
script pubkey
OP_0 OP_PUSHBYTES_20 317f51603bcbce955fdf83073436bfd920fec8da
address
ltc1qx9l4zcpme08f2h7lsvrngd4lmys0ajx6s080n3
transaction
e05406b430a8c889a31fff7ff4b9e458666603213a125838e3b61b6fd0e3f05e
spent
true